A system is described by means of which a 45 MHz radio telescope can simultaneously conduct observations in four different directions. The system incorporates a four-channel receiver, two sets of four integrators,a high-accuracy digital-to-analog converter, an automatic offset system, and a minicomputer with peripherals. Despite the fourfold increase in the amount of information obtained, no deterioration of radio telescope sensitivity or measurement accuracy has been noted.
